Center pivot irrigation is a form of overhead sprinkler irrigation consisting of several segments of pipe (usually galvanized steel or aluminum) with sprinklers positioned along their length, joined together and supported by trusses, and mounted on wheeled towers. Most center pivot systems now have drops hanging from a U-shaped pipe called a gooseneck attached at the top of the pipe[clarification needed] with sprinkler heads that are positioned a few feet (at most) above the crop, thus limiting evaporative losses and wind drift. [1][2] A circular area centered on the pivot is irrigated, often creating a circular pattern in crops when viewed from above (sometimes referred to as crop circles, not to be confused with those formed by circular flattening of a section of a crop in a field). Drops can also be used with drag hoses or bubblers that deposit the water directly on the ground between crops. In 1993, historian John Opie observed that industrial irrigation that emerged in the Great Plains was a three-legged stool supported by fertile land, plentiful and low-cost groundwater, and inexpensive fuel. More than 95 percent of Egypt is uninhabitable desert with an average annual precipitation of 0 millimeters. They proposed classifying each acre according to its productive capacity and buying out land deemed as submarginal. The end of the drought and the onset of World War II, however, allowed the resumption of maximum production and scrapped the dreams of land use planners. In the early 19th century, the first Euro-American explorers labeled the region between the Rocky Mountains and the 100th meridian as the Great American Desert, a depiction that had remarkable staying power. Any one of these farms requires more water for drinking and waste removal than a typical city: A farm of 20,000 hogs uses far more water than a community of 20,000 people. Daugherty's engineers spent the next decade refining Zybach's innovation, making it sturdier, taller, and more reliable, and converting it from a hydraulic power system to electric drive. Center pivots are typically less than 500 meters (1,600ft) in length (circle radius) with the most common size being the standard .mw-parser-output .frac{white-space:nowrap}.mw-parser-output .frac .num,.mw-parser-output .frac .den{font-size:80%;line-height:0;vertical-align:super}.mw-parser-output .frac .den{vertical-align:sub}.mw-parser-output .sr-only{border:0;clip:rect(0,0,0,0);height:1px;margin:-1px;overflow:hidden;padding:0;position:absolute;width:1px}400-meter (14mi) machine, which covers about 50 hectares (125 acres) of land.[8]. It would take hundreds to thousands of years of rainfall to replace the groundwater in the dried up aquifer.[10]. Pressure regulators are typically installed upstream of each nozzle to ensure each is operating at the correct design pressure.
